Located in south-western France, the Lot region boasts breathtaking scenery and a unique heritage. From the village of Rocamadour (pictured) to the city of Cahors, FRANCE 24 takes you to discover a land where rugby reigns supreme and local wines blend all the flavours of the region.

I lived through the seventies as a young boy in a village nestled in the Lot valley. As a young kid it felt so remote from civilization, there was no freeway access, barely one TV station you could pick up, 2 faint radio stations I could listen music from on my alarm clock radio, biggest town Toulouse was a 3 hours drive on windy roads. Yet at the same time it felt so connected to history, you could literally pick up cavemen rocks and arrow heads off the ground, hear about the last Gaul battle in the region, and cross the Valentré bridge twice a day to go to school. In hindsight after all those years traveling the world, I can only remember how beautiful and peaceful that place was, and how blessed those young years were.
